EU considers imposing 37% tariffs on Israel

ALBAWABA - The EU proposed on Tuesday to slap huge tariffs on Israel as a way to pressure Tel Aviv to stop the war in Gaza. The European Commission suggested imposing tariffs on Israeli goods over the deadly war in Gaza and ongoing violations in the West Bank.
